Output 26fa8114f31909f5d59cd0f7d3e16500c2a9610331471d91367f5a18c19109aa:0

value
4821450133
script pubkey
OP_0 OP_PUSHBYTES_20 41cdc138ca6639777e0ac74ed2aba1899d3fd623
address
tb1qg8xuzwx2vcuhwls2ca8d92ap3xwnl43r2k7hrk
transaction
26fa8114f31909f5d59cd0f7d3e16500c2a9610331471d91367f5a18c19109aa
confirmations
118157
spent
true